Websites Hosted on 104.21.41.91
› Rumble.com (0 seconds ago) / US
› Activeelement.org (0 seconds ago) / US
› Buildingmarketintelligence.com (15 seconds ago) / VG
› Sxsstrategy.com (16 seconds ago) / US
› Surga55.info (28 seconds ago) / US
› Universalstudioshollywood.com (52 seconds ago) / US